8

wpfでgridviewcolumnheaderとしてgridviewcolumnのヘッダーにアクセスすることは可能ですか?

私はオブジェクトを持っています:

GridViewColumn column;

ただし、「Header」プロパティは、「実際の」ヘッダーオブジェクトではなく、文字列(ヘッダーテキスト)を返すだけです。

誰かが私を助けることができますか?

4

2 に答える 2

3

私自身、WPF には非常に不慣れですが、GridViewColumnHeader を定義しないと、.Header にアクセスするときに GridViewColumnHeader が与えられないようです。

つまり、GridViewColumn を次のように定義すると、

                <GridViewColumn x:Name="stringColumn">
                    stringColumn.Header will return a string
                </GridViewColumn>

次に、stringColumn.Header を呼び出すと、文字列が返されます...ただし、次のように定義した場合:

                <GridViewColumn x:Name="gridViewColumnHeaderColumn1">
                    <GridViewColumnHeader>
                        gridViewColumnHeaderColumn.Header will return a GridViewColumnHeaderColumn
                    </GridViewColumnHeader>
                </GridViewColumn>

次に、gridViewColumnHeaderColumn.Header をチェックすると、GridViewColumnHeaderColumn が返されます。

于 2011-04-04T22:35:15.100 に答える